INTRODUCTION
The 4th IFRC 2026 will feature research presentations, discussions in plenary sessions, poster presentations, as well as panel discussion sessions related to the field of food research. The plenary sessions and panel discussions will be joined by renowned experts from both local and international backgrounds. In addition, the 4th IFRC 2026 will also host pre-conference events comprising several concurrent pre-conference workshops in the fields of food science, food technology, and food services. The 4th IFRC 2026 will provide opportunities for meetings and the sharing of experiences among scientists, researchers, academics, entrepreneurs, industry experts, policymakers, government agencies, local and international non-governmental organisations (NGOs), as well as undergraduate and postgraduate students in the field of food. Selected papers are invited to submit full manuscript to International Food Research Journal (science and technology) and International Food Insights Journal (social science) subjected to article processing fees.

Submission Format
Abstract Format
To submit your abstract, it is mandatory to register as a participant for the conference. Before submitting your abstract, carefully review and adhere to the guidelines provided below:
• The abstract should be composed in British English and serve as an informative summary of the research work.
• Font Type: Arial
• Font Sizes:
• Title: 14.0 point
• Authors’ List: 12.0 point
• Affiliations: 10.5 point
• Corresponding Author’s Email: 10.5 point
• Main Text of Abstract: 12.0 point
• Keywords: 12.0 point
• Single-line spacing is required, aligned left, except for the body of the abstract, which should be justified. Margins for left,
right, top, and bottom should be 2.54 cm (1 inch).
• All abstracts should follow the structured format; with the subheadings of Introduction, Methods,
Results and Conclusion. Bold the subheadings.
• The abstract should not exceed 300 words.
• Expand any abbreviations or acronyms in their full term upon first use, unless they are standard units of measurement.
• Exclude references in the abstract.
• Include a maximum of 5 keywords aiding cross-indexing of the article.
Poster Format
Physical poster:
Poster dimension: A1 (594 mm width × 1189 mm height), portrait orientation.
Title and Authors: Should be similar to the accepted abstract.
Visuals: Text size should be readable from a distance of 5 feet.
Presentation Session: All presentation must be delivered in English. The presence of author/s will be required during the allocated poster judging session.
Virtual poster:
The poster should be a clear visual presentation of your submitted abstract and should meet the following criteria:
Title of the Poster: It is recommended to keep the title of the poster the same as in the submitted abstract. Slight modification, which does not change the idea of the abstract, is also allowed.
Poster Size and Format:
• The poster must be submitted in PDF format.
• Recommended poster size: 1280 × 720 pixels, optimised for online viewing using a landscape orientation (16:9 ratio).
• A poster should contain the following sections:
o Title, authors, and institution(s)
o Abstract
o Materials and Methods
o Results and Discussion
o Conclusion
o Acknowledgement
o References
Your Information:
• The name of the PDF document should contain the IFRC ID and the name of the presenter.
• E.g.: 117-043 John, D.
• Please put your IFRC ID on the top right corner of the poster.
